COVID-19: one new positive case and three recoveries on Saturday 24 October
One new positive case of COVID-19 was recorded this Saturday.
This brings the Principality’s total coronavirus cases to 296.
This evening, eight patients are being treated at Princess Grace Hospital, five of whom, including two residents, are in intensive care. Two of the other three patients in hospital are also residents.
Three recoveries have been reported, bringing the total number of people who have so far recovered to 244.
This Saturday evening, 44 people are being monitored by the Home Patient Follow-Up Centre, which offers medical support to those with minor symptoms who are asked to self-isolate at home.
In accordance with the practices adopted by the World Health Organization and neighbouring countries in this area, this daily update reports coronavirus cases among residents only.
